发明名称 Height of cut adjustment system for mower cutting deck
摘要 A mower carrying a rotary cutting deck has a height of cut system for adjusting the vertical position of the deck relative to the mower frame for changing or adjusting the height of cut. The height of cut system comprises a pair of parallel cross shafts that carry a plurality of pivotal suspension linkages that connect to the deck, the cross shafts and linkages pivoting jointly with one another and with a pivotal control lever. One of the cross shafts carries a torsion spring to counterbalance the weight of the deck. The control lever is maintained in a plurality of adjusted pivotal positions by a height selection bracket fixed to the frame with the height selection bracket being capable of having its position changed or adjusted relative to the frame by a single adjustment bolt. Each suspension linkage has its effective length adjusted by turning a threaded adjuster carried at the upper end of a connecting rod that is part of each linkage to allow the deck to be leveled relative to a reference plane. The adjustment of the height selection bracket is accomplished without affecting the length adjustments previously made to any of the suspension linkages.

主权项 1. An improved mower of the type having a mower frame, a rotary cutting deck carried by the frame, a height of cut system for vertically moving the cutting deck upwardly and downwardly relative to the frame to adjust the height of cut of the grass, wherein the height of cut system comprises a plurality of pivotal suspension linkages connecting the cutting deck to the frame, a single pivotal control lever pivotally carried on the frame with pivoting of the control lever causing joint and corresponding pivoting motion in all the suspension linkages, and a height selection bracket fixed to the frame and coacting with the pivotal control lever to set and maintain the control lever in different pivotal positions corresponding to different heights of cut, wherein the improvement relates to the height of cut adjustment system and comprises: a) a latch movably carried on the height of selection bracket for latching the control lever in a maximum height of cut position; b) a handle movably carried on the height of selection bracket for moving the latch out of engagement with the control lever when the operator slides the handle in a first direction on the height of selection bracket; c) at least one spring that biases the latch into a position in which the latch engages the control lever and that biases the handle in a direction opposite to the first direction in which the operator slides the handle to release the latch; and d) a locking slot into which the operator can move the handle after the handle is first moved by the operator in the first direction sufficiently to release the latch, wherein the operator can move the handle into the locking slot by movement of the handle in a second direction that is different than the first direction with the bias of the spring retaining the handle in the locking slot thereafter to thereby disable the operation of the latch until the handle is moved back out of the locking slot by the operator.
